A large open tank has two holes in the wall. One is a square hold of side L at a depth y from the top and the other is a circular hole of radius R at a depth 4y from the top. When the tank is completely filled with water, the quantities of water flowing out per second from both the holes are the same. Then, R is equal to:

Solution

The correct option is A L/2π
Velocity of efflux at a depth h is given by V=2gh
Given, by equation of continuity :a1V1=a2V2
L22gy=πR22g4y or R=L/2π
